
In today’s world, projects are vital for the success of a business due to the fast-paced and constantly competitive market environments. A project is ‘a temporary endeavour undertaken to create a unique product, service or result.’ i In other words, projects are new initiatives that businesses undertake to improve their operations or to gain a competitive advantage over their competitors. Projects are characterised by uniqueness, something that a company has not undertaken before, and temporary nature ending potentially when the new practice becomes a new ‘business-as-usual’ output or outcome.
